Dreaming about a pighead can carry a multitude of meanings, depending on the context of the dream and the dreamer's personal experiences. Each interpretation by different dream analysts can reveal unique insights.

Miller's Dream Interpretation suggests that dreaming of a pighead might signify wealth and abundance, but it also warns against gluttony and excess. Seeing a pig or its head in a dream could indicate that the dreamer is experiencing material success or is about to enter a phase of prosperity. However, the dream also serves as a cautionary tale against overindulgence and losing sight of moral and ethical boundaries. If the pighead is clean and well-presented, it could symbolize good fortune, while a dirty or disfigured pighead might indicate that the dreamer is neglecting important aspects of their life in pursuit of material wealth.

In contrast, Vanga's interpretation leans more towards the symbolic and emotional meanings behind the image of a pighead. Vanga believed that dreams can reveal hidden feelings about oneself and one’s relationships. Seeing a pighead could symbolize feelings of guilt or shame, perhaps indicating that the dreamer is involved in something that they find morally questionable. Vanga's perspective highlights the importance of self-reflection; a pighead may point to unresolved issues regarding one's values or choices. Thus, the dream encourages the dreamer to confront these feelings and to make necessary changes to live in accordance with their ethical beliefs.

From a Freudian perspective, dreaming of a pighead might tap into deeper psychological issues related to repression and instinctual desires. Freud believed that animals in dreams often represent our primal urges and instincts. A pighead, specifically, may symbolize desires tied to indulgence, lust, or carnal pleasures. Freud would suggest that the prominence of a pighead in your dreams could point to a conflict between societal expectations and personal desires, revealing a struggle with repressed emotions or impulses. Such a dream might prompt the dreamer to examine their relationship with their instincts and to consider whether they are suppressing important aspects of their identity. The dream could serve as a reminder to find a balance between responsibility and the fulfillment of one’s desires.

The Muslim Dreamer offers insight rooted in spirituality and cultural context. In many Islamic traditions, pigs are seen as impure creatures, and dreaming of a pig or a pighead can indicate something negative. It could symbolize sin, corruption, or harmful influences in the dreamer's life. The dream might be a warning to distance oneself from negative influences or practices that contradict Islamic teachings. It may suggest that the dreamer needs to seek purification of their soul or change certain behaviors that are considered immoral or harmful. The presence of a pighead in the dream could, therefore, serve as a wake-up call to reflect on one’s actions and their alignment with spiritual beliefs.
